Pop purveyors seem to be a signature Scandinavian export these days, and Martin Tungevåg, aka Tungevaag, is proof that these stars have staying power, too. After rising eight spots in last year’s Top 100 DJs poll, the Grammy-nominated Norwegian producer teamed up with Timmy Trumpet to release ‘La Danse’ as his parting gift to 2022 — and he’s been rewarded by rising another eight places this year. The energetic cut, which arrived via Spinnin’ Records in December, includes soaring vocals, bi-lingual lyrics, and an invigorating hardstyle breakdown. That track went on to ignite festival fields in the months ahead, and even helped Tungevaag surpass another impressive milestone — he crossed seven billion streams worldwide. Following an exciting performance at this year’s Tomorrowland festival, his numbers continue to climb higher than even the mountaintops in his Alesund hometown. When asked what he’s been up to these past 12 months, his answer is simple: “Making music I love.”

A mainstay of the electronic scene for almost 20 years now, Stuttgart native Le Shuuk is no stranger to the rigours of touring. In the last 12 months, he decided to overhaul his lifestyle, committing to exercising regularly and abstaining from drinking during his shows. As a result, the DJ and producer, who is a favourite of the German festival circuit, says that he is having more fun on stage than ever. He credits these changes with allowing him to connect on a deeper level with his audiences, as well as redefine his career goals and look with renewed focus to the future.

The new healthy habits clearly agree with him. As well as recently performing at festivals and clubs across Europe, and holding his own Le Shuuk & Friends parties in his home city, he continues to build on the momentum of tracks like 2020’s peak-rave, German language tune ‘Sandmann’ and 2021’s hypnotic ‘Goodbye’ (featuring Xillions). This year he had another star turn with the explosive ‘Konje’, a collaboration with B-Stylezz that combined modern techno and EDM with the traditional elements of Bulgarian folk songs, with the track receiving big support from the likes of Armin van Buuren, Amelie Lens, and Joyhauser.
